Senator Castro (PS) for frustrated dialogue between isapres and the Government: “They desperately asked for a table and then they threw the tablecloth”

The senator Juan Luis Castro (PS) discussed this Monday the departure of the Association of Isapres from the work table with the Ministry of Health (Minsal), an instance formed due to the crisis that insurers are going through. In this regard, the legislator commented that the isapres “threw the tablecloth.”

Let us remember that a ruling of the Supreme Court -of November 30, 2022- established that all health and complementary plans must apply the table of factors of the Superintendency of Health, which came into force in 2020.

“The isapres built their own scenario. They blame the government for their ills. They desperately requested a dialogue table. They sat at the table, went to two meetings and then threw the tablecloth, saying that the government did not listen to them,” stated Senator Castro -member of the Senate Health Commission- in conversation with The Counter in La Clave.

“The Government raised two things: one, an appeal for clarification, that the Supreme Court ruled in 24 hours, which says that the Superintendent of Health cannot intervene on the base price of the plans,” added the parliamentarian PS.

“The second thing that the Government has done is that it is going to present the country with a bill to strengthen Fonasa and have a new modality of care, in addition to hospital, in addition to free choice, it is going to incorporate a modality for purchasing insurance complementary to health plans”.

With this, Fonasa “will be able in this scenario, with a new law, to be in a position to receive, on equal terms, people who eventually leave an isapre or any citizen who wants to have private coverage as well. It turns out that with that information the isapres say ‘no, we’re leaving,'” he said.

Regarding the ruling of the Supreme Court, he said that it is “very categorical and in favor of the people, in favor of the people, because this world of the isapres tripped itself when the users of the system began to go to court, It started to go well for people when they raised the price of the plans. This comes about four, five years ago. It went on increasing.”

“95% of the cases that come before the Supreme Court of Chile are from isapres. 95%. That speaks of the level of indignation of the people,” he said.

Lists: the official discussion

Senator Castro also addressed the discussion within the ruling party for the electoral lists for the election of the Constitutional Council. The Central Committee of the PS decided yesterday to go on a single list, while the National Council of the PPD determined to go on a separate list with Democratic Socialism.

“All the parties say they support the government, and we say ‘if that’s the case, let’s prove it,'” said the parliamentarian.

“If we go on two lists (…) it will be the responsibility of those who have said over and over again that they privilege their identity, their sector, their legitimate way of seeing things, but not the unity of the entire conglomerate, and People know that I am referring to the PPD, the radicals and some others, and they are in that position that I hope they rectify in these days,” he added.

“If it is about putting the success of the changes we want in the Constitution above that identity, having a majority and not losing 3/5, which is the quorum to make the changes, I think the risk is too much, it is too much. “, he continued.

Along these lines, he maintained that “if we start from the base of self-dividing, of self-segmenting, in something that people are not going to understand very much, also with an electoral risk of defeat, please, it is like the prelude to the prophecy, that All of this is going to go wrong because it started badly”.
